I. Job Summary
The Senior Account Executive (SAE) role is responsible for prospecting and closing sales to new customers to achieve budgeted sales goals. This position develops and implements sound selling strategies that ensure revenue growth at target or greater profitability levels by selling to new customers. Additionally, the role is responsible for managing existing business relationships in order to achieve budgeted sales and price goals by developing and implementing sound retention strategies, utilizing strong negotiation efforts to preserve business, and securing contract agreements from previously non-contracted customers.
The Senior Account Executive will "save, secure, and convert" by handling all customer cancellation requests, providing ongoing education of contract details to existing customers, and by obtaining customer contract commitments during face-to-face interactions. All escalations for customer service within the defined territory will be resolved through this position. SAEs are responsible for maintaining and growing billable value in their assigned accounts.
This position is a hybrid position requiring the employee to reside in the greater Mason City, IA area. The position will require the employee to work part of the week at a WM area office, part of the week from home and will require frequent customer site visits.

The expected base pay range for this hybrid position is $61,100 - $84,180. This range represents a good faith estimate for this position. The specific salary offered to a successful candidate may be influenced by a variety of factors including the candidate’s relevant experience, education, training, certifications, qualifications, and work location. In addition, this position is eligible for incentive pay.
Benefits
At WM, each eligible employee receives a competitive total compensation package including Medical, Dental, Vision, Life Insurance and Short Term Disability. As well as a Stock Purchase Plan, Pension, and more! Our employees also receive Paid Vacation, Holidays, and Personal Days. Please note that benefits may vary by site.
